= Regional Sales Review — Managers Only =

Scope: Q3 results, Northvale and Carrow districts, Orison Ltd.

Northvale beat target by 6%; Carrow missed by 11%, driven by delayed Fenwick renewals. Actions: reallocate two reps to Carrow, freeze non-essential travel, accelerate the Harbrook pilot. Branch managers must update forecasts by month-end and flag at-risk accounts weekly. Do not share district figures outside this page. Context on how these moves fit the wider strategy is given in the confidential note below.

internal memo for kawip-hadug: Headcount on the Wenwyn team goes from 7 to 140 by the end of January. Gross margin on Wenwyn came in at 20 percent against a plan of 15 percent.

For the incoming director: the sale of Corvalle Packaging to Hathersedge Group closed last quarter at a modest premium to book value. Proceeds were applied first to retiring the revolving facility, with the remainder held in reserve pending board direction. Transition services run through year-end, and two warranty claims remain open but adequately provisioned. Please review the reconciliation schedules before the next audit cycle. The confidential note below outlines the intended use of remaining proceeds.

board note of baweg-bawig: Project Tamath slips by six weeks because of the audit delay.

## Limits and Quotas — Verdance Schema Registry

The registry enforces per-tenant caps on schema count, payload size, and registration rate. Exceeding a cap returns a throttled response rather than an error, and repeated violations suspend write access pending review. All caps are enforced server-side and cannot be bypassed by client configuration. The enforced values, which security sign-off covers, are defined below.

limits module of tafop-hahop:
WEIGHTS = {
    "julmir": 223,
    "belox": 987,
    "lamion": 470,
    "pelath": 609,
    "fraok": 1010,
    "eliion": 343,
    "drudor": 342,
}

Subject: Quickstore 4.2 — bloom filter now fronts the KV layer

Plugin authors: starting with this release, Quickstore places a bloom filter ahead of the key-value store. Negative lookups return faster; false positives fall through safely. No API changes are required on your side. Verify your plugin against the staging build referenced below.

session token of fahif-tadup = htk3_9c7